Discord, founded in 2015 by Jason Citron and Stan Vishnevskiy, began as a voice chat platform for gamers but has evolved into a global community hub with over 150 million monthly active users. Its real‑time, low‑latency communication stack—combining text, voice, and video channels—has become the standard for online collaboration, and its open API has spawned thousands of bots and integrations that power millions of servers worldwide.

Product Safety Operations Manager

Company: Discord

Location: San Francisco, CA

Posted Apr 07, 2023

The text describes a role for a Manager in the Product Safety Operations team at Discord, responsible for leading the team, partnering with other teams, assessing risk, and implementing safety measures. The Manager will work closely with various internal and external stakeholders, manage a team of Trust & Safety specialists, and ensure a tight feedback loop between users and product teams. The role requires 3-5+ years of experience in project management, strategy, or related roles, and strong experience working on product development and partnering with technical/engineering teams. The US base salary range for this full-time position is $145,000 to $158,000 + equity + benefits.

How can I stand out as an applicant for Discord jobs?
Demonstrate a passion for community building by showcasing projects that involve real‑time communication or moderation. Highlight technical achievements such as low‑latency networking, scalable microservices, or open‑source contributions to related projects. Include metrics that show impact—e.g., reduced server latency by X% or increased user engagement by Y%—and tailor your resume to the specific role. When applying, mention familiarity with Discord’s API, and provide a link to a portfolio or GitHub repository that reflects the skills the hiring team seeks.
